Many "free" stresser services are secretly run by law enforcement agencies (such as the FBI or Europol) as honey pots to gather data on aspiring cybercriminals. Even when operated by actual malicious actors, these panels log user IP addresses, email addresses, and payment details. If the service is eventually seized by authorities—which happens frequently—the entire user database falls into the hands of global law enforcement. 3. Severe Legal Consequences

A DDoS attack panel, often marketed legally as an "IP stresser" or "booter," is a web-based interface that allows users to launch cyberattacks without writing code or managing infrastructure. These platforms abstract the technical complexity of botnets and server amplification networks into a simple dashboard.

Most free panels are promotional entry points for paid subscription models. The free tier is strictly limited, offering short attack durations (e.g., 30 to 60 seconds) and low traffic volume (measured in Megabits per second). These restrictions prevent users from taking down well-protected enterprise targets but are often sufficient to disrupt unprotected home internet connections or small gaming servers.
